Abstract
A control apparatus for an internal combustion engine in which the condition of the operating parameters of the engine is changed over according to the detected result of the occurrence of knocks only when the engine lies in a predetermined operating region. The operating parameters include an ignition timing, a supercharging pressure, a compression ratio, and an air/fuel ratio. The knocks of the engine are integrated and compared with a threshold level to determine which of premium or regular gasoline is being used. In this determination, if the operating region lies in said predetermined operating region, the condition of the operating parameters is changed over. The predetermined operating region is defined by a load information and a speed information of the engine.
